Screenplay Submissions 2012. Terms and Conditions.

Closing Day: 30 May 2012 (postmarked)

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S

1. Screenplay Categories: feature fiction and short.

2. Eligible screenplays by:

a) Greek Origin Individuals and Production Companies from all over the world, with no specific subject in their work (Greek Diaspora & Greek-Cypriots included),

b) International Individuals and Production Companies from all over the world, with film or screenplay related to Greece (i.e. subject, myths, history, locations or filming in Greece). 

3. We don't accept works in progress, just ideas, unregistered or uncompleted scripts.
